Overview of the Brand's Heritage
Founded in 1969, Rip Curl has remained at the forefront of the surfing culture, embodying the ethos of the surfing lifestyle. The company was initially started by surfers Brian Singer and Douglas Warbrick in Torquay, Australia, aspiring to create the best wetsuits for the emerging surf scene. Over the decades, this passion has expanded beyond wetsuits into a full range of products that resonate with adventure seekers around the globe.
Rip Curl’s heritage is steeped in innovation and relentless pursuit of quality. The brand's commitment is evident in their slogan, "The Ultimate Surfing Company". This drives their unwavering focus on functionality without sacrificing aesthetics, making their products accessible and appealing to women who embody the surf spirit.

Leather vs. Synthetic Straps
The debate between leather and synthetic straps is unending. On one side, you have leather, a classic choice that brings an air of sophistication to any watch. It molds comfortably to the wrist with time, creating a unique fit for the wearer. Many enthusiasts appreciate leather for its timeless appeal and the versatility it offers—working just as well with casual outfits as with more formal attire.
However, it’s important to remember that leather is a natural material and often requires care and maintenance to keep it looking its best. It can be susceptible to moisture, which is a consideration for anyone engaging in water sports, for example.
On the flip side, synthetic straps made from materials like silicone or polyurethane present a robust alternative. They are often more water-resistant and can handle environmental stresses typically experienced during outdoor activities. Features like quick-dry technology make them a preferred choice for extreme athletes who demand performance.
Yet, some might argue that synthetic straps lack the character of leather, which can result in lower perceived value to certain consumers. Nevertheless, given the array of styles and colors available in synthetic options, they provide a practical and often more cost-effective choice for daily wear.
Glass Types and Their Benefits
The watch glass significantly influences durability and clarity. Common types include mineral glass, sapphire crystal, and acrylic. Mineral glass is what most brands use due to its affordability, providing decent scratch resistance while allowing for a clean, clear view. On the other hand, sapphire crystal is the choice for luxury components; it offers superior scratch resistance, making it an exceptional option for those who engage in rugged activities. Acrylic, while less scratch-resistant, is lightweight and minimizes the chances of shattering on impact.
Choosing the right glass type ultimately depends on the user’s lifestyle and preferences. For extreme sports enthusiasts, the added durability of sapphire might be worth the investment, while everyday wearers may find that mineral glass suits their needs just fine.
